何氏養巢顆粒干預DOR小鼠卵巢功能的藥效學研究

Pharmacodynamic studies of He's Yangchao Decoction on Ovarian Function in DOR Rats

摘要


目的:研究何氏養巢顆粒對小鼠卵巢儲備功能下降(DOR)的防治作用。方法:取動情週期正常ICR雌鼠分為對照組、模型組、DHEA組及養巢顆粒低、中、高劑量組,每組各10只,除對照組外其他組均採用環磷醯胺(CTX)誘導DOR小鼠模型,分別予生理鹽水及脫氫表雄酮(DHEA)、養巢顆粒灌胃8周。陰道塗片觀察動情週期,分時段檢測血清促卵泡刺激素(FSH)、促黃體生成素(LH)、雌二醇(E2)、抗穆勒氏管激素(AMH)、抑制素B(INHB),解剖後計算卵巢、子宮係數,光鏡下觀察卵巢形態組織學變化。結果:與對照組比較,模型組小鼠動情週期延長,FSH、LH值升高且AMH下降(P<0.05);與模型組比較,DHEA組、養巢顆粒各劑量組的FSH值下降,E2、INHB值升高,高劑量組AMH顯著增高(P<0.05);相較於第4周,第8周模型組及DHEA組的FSH值較前明顯升高(P<0.05),而養巢顆粒組小鼠的FSH、LH較前次檢測無明顯變化(P>0.05)。觀察卵巢組織形態可見相較於模型組,DHEA及養巢顆粒各組均可見卵巢中各級卵泡數目增多且閉鎖卵泡減少。結論:何氏養巢顆粒能夠調節性激素水準、減緩卵泡閉鎖,對改善卵巢儲備功能具有良好的效果,能夠及時防治DOR的進一步發展。

並列摘要


OBJECTIVE: To study the preventive and therapeutic effects of He's Yangchao Decoction on ovaries of rats with Diminished Ovarian Reserve (DOR). METHODS: ICR female rats with normal estrus cycle were divided into control group, model group, dehydroepiandrosterone (DHEA) group, and low-, medium-, and high-dose groups of Yangchao Decoction, with 10 rats in each group. All other groups except the control group were treated with cyclophosphamide (CTX). Saline, DHEA (11mg.kg-1), low dose (2.4g.kg-1), medium dose (4.8g.kg-1) and high dose (9.6g.kg-1) of Yangchao Decoction was administered for 8 weeks. Vaginal smear was used to observe estrous cycle. Two times of serum follicle stimulating hormone (FSH), luteinizing hormone (LH), estradiol (E2), anti-Mullerian hormone (AMH), and inhibinB were detected. The ovarian and uterus coefficients were calculated after dissection, and the morphology of ovary and the growth and development of follicles were observed under light microscope. RESULTS: Compared with the control group, the estrous cycle of the model group was prolonged, the FSH and LH values were increased, and the AMH was decreased (P<0.05). Compared with the model group, the FSH values of the DHEA group and the Yangchao Decoction decreased, E2 and inhibin B (INHB) value increased, the LH value of the medium and high dose Yangchao Decoction group decreased, and the AMH of the high dose group increased significantly (P<0.05); The FSH values of the model group and the DHEA group were significantly higher than before (P<0.05), while the FSH and LH values of the Yangchao Decoction group had no significant change compared with the previous one (P>0.05). The morphology of ovarian tissue was observed, and compared with the model group, the number of follicles in the ovary increased and the number of atretic follicles decreased in the DHEA group and the Yangchao Decoction group. CONCLUSION: He's Yangchao Decoction can regulate the level of sex hormones, slow down follicular atresia, and has a good effect on improving ovarian reserve function, and can prevent and control the further development of DOR.
